Katya Eckert is the founder and CEO of A DOMANI. Inspired by her own personal experiences with postpartum night sweats and her mother's battle with breast cancer, she created the company to support women through life’s transitions with sleepwear that offers both comfort and functionality. The brand's innovative approach has earned it recognition, including the 2025 Oprah Daily Menopause O-Wards, and has been featured on CBS’ Changing the Game series.
Prior to founding A DOMANI, Katya spent 15 years in institutional finance at Macro Risk Advisors, where she held roles in marketing and business development, and passed her Series 7 and 63 exams. She also served as Head of Member Relations at Quintessentially, a luxury lifestyle group. Katya holds a BA in Art History and Communications from Rutgers University, is certified by the Institute of Integrative Nutrition, and completed a 200-hour Yoga Teacher Training at The Shala in NYC. She resides in Greenwich, Connecticut, with her husband John and their two children, Zoe and Max.
